Free Music Notes for The Patriot: Original Motion Picture Score (2000 Film)Free Music Review: Wow! Hit: 5 StarsThe first track of this CD is absolutely amazing. Mark O'Connor's violin playing is sublime. I'm only sorry that it took me so long to come across this masterpiece by John Williams. Yes, people know about Star Wars and Jurassic Park, but this score is equally moving and triumphant. One of my new favorites!

Free Music Review: Great Soundtrack...just try not to love it... Hit: 5 StarsAs usual, John Williams has created a very special soundtrack. It's so patriotic sounding that you can't help but love it. Especially Track number 4 (The Colonial Cause). That is w/o a doubt one of the most impactful orchestral pieces that I have ever heard. Great job Mr. Williams....great job.

Free Music Review: Soul-stirring Hit: 4 StarsWould recommend to friends solely for the entrancing, heart-rending solo by violinest (er, sorry, 'fiddler') Mike Myers. This Applachian-style melody is equally elusive and unforgettable in its haunted wandering. All the tracks are at least interesting and follow the strong Williams theme well, though its rather intense for casual listening. It is from an action-movie, after all...
